For the first time ever, the Utah National Guard has been deployed to assist at a hospital due to staffing shortages

ST. GEORGE, Utah — Utah National Guard service members have been deployed to a hospital to assist in non-clinical support roles.

Intermountain Healthcare operations officer Mark Evans said Guard members will help out in areas such as environmental services, housekeeping, food services and patient transport. Evans added that the St. George hospital has been operating at capacity for a while now and thanked the Guard members for their help.
